For the silver foil of freshness that keeps my coffee dry
For the broken golden bottle top that kept the ale fine
For the lid upon the butter tub
For all things vacuumed packed
For needless plastic wrappings and little food bags
For the fridge
The freezer
And the flask
For the tuppaware too
For ice
For brine
For the right appliance
For cryogenics too
Formaldehyde
For U.H.T
For jars of pickled fruit
For preservation
Conservation
And permanence in food
